Jack Donaldson owns and operates Jack's Abstracting Service.Jack's two revenue generating operations (Abstracting Services and Closing Services)are supported by two service departments: Clerical and Custodial.Costs in the service departments are allocated in the following order using the designated allocation bases.Clerical: number of transactions processed.Custodial: square footage of space occupied.Average and expected activity levels for next month are as follows:  Number of  Transactions  Square  Footage  Expected  Costs  Abstract services 501,800 Closing services 252,200 Clerical 1,600$40,000 Custodial 510,000\begin{array} { | l r | r | r | } \hline & \begin{array} { r } \text { Number of } \\\text { Transactions }\end{array} & \begin{array} { r } \text { Square } \\\text { Footage }\end{array} & \begin{array} { r } \text { Expected } \\\text { Costs }\end{array} \\\text { Abstract services } & 50 & 1,800 & \\\hline \text { Closing services } & 25 & 2,200 & \\\hline \text { Clerical } & & 1,600 & \$ 40,000 \\\hline \text { Custodial } & 5 & &10,000 \\\hline\end{array}
Required:
Use the reciprocal method to allocate the service department costs to the revenue generating departments.Provide the total costs for the revenue departments.
